Ethanol Fireplaces
Ethanol Fireplaces don't need chimneys, flues, or gas lines. This makes them easy to install, particularly in apartments and condominiums. Vent-free fireplaces come in tabletop fireplace, wall mounted or freestanding models.
They also create no smoke or ash, and require minimal maintenance. Learn more about ethanol fireplaces.
1. Environmentally Friendly
Ethanol Fireplaces are an eco sustainable alternative to wood fireplaces-burning stoves and traditional chimney fireplaces. They provide the same ambience and fire-look, without the ash piles and soot that are typical of fireplaces. They can be utilized in nearly any room in your home or office.
It is essential to follow all safety guidelines when adding an bioethanol fireplace to your house. The owner's guide included with each bioethanol fireplace will likely provide the safety guidelines. Some examples include avoiding adding more fuel to a fireplace that is burning bioethanol fire and always allow it to cool completely before refilling. Also, keep your bioethanol fire safe from any combustible materials and do not move it when it is burning.
The use of ethanol fireplaces are safer than those which run on gas. They do not emit carbon monoxide that could cause serious harm to your health. As with any open flame fireplace, it's crucial to keep them out from children and combustibles. In the event of a fire it is essential to keep a fire extinguisher in your home.
Fireplaces made of ethanol require less maintenance than traditional fireplaces since they don't produce smoke, soot or odor. They don't require complicated ventilation systems or chimneys to circulate air. This makes them a more appealing and practical choice for homeowners who want to enjoy the look and feel of a real fire without the hassle.
Although ethanol fireplaces provide warmth, they don't offer the same amount of heat as a gas or wood-burning stove. They might not be the ideal choice for those who are looking to upgrade their heating system.
While ethanol fireplaces are safe and simple to operate, they must be properly installed and used in order to avoid fire or damage dangers. It is essential to follow the manufacturer's instructions for installation and be cautious not to put them in areas that are flammable, including clothing or curtains. It is recommended to keep them at least one meter away from children and pets, and to be cautious when lighting them.
2. No Ash or Smoke
Ethanol fireplaces are a great choice for those who are concerned about the environment. They produce no smoke or water, and have no chimneys or pipes. This makes them a great alternative to traditional fireplaces, which generate plenty of smoke and ash, which must be removed from the chimney as well as other areas of the house.
The majority of ethanol burners come with an easy-to-use control panel that allows you to alter the flame's size and brightness as well as switch the unit on and off. The lid that comes with it can be used to extinguish the flame by pushing it against the opening. Since a fire is still burning in the burner it's important to be careful. Keep it away from fabrics or clothing that could catch fire.
Apart from a tiny amount of soot that might accumulate on the burner or on other surfaces, ethanol fireplaces are smoke and ash free. This makes them a great alternative for homes with pets or children. They can also be used in restaurants, bars, and commercial spaces.
You can install ethanol fireplaces in any room, even those without chimneys, as they do not require vents. They can even be utilized outdoors, which is why they are popular in hotels and spas. Most models are freestanding, and don't require installation. However, some models can be installed in the wall or made to create a "firebox".
Installing an ethanol fire feature is more affordable because it doesn't require an chimney or flue. Certain models are mobile and can be moved easily and is a huge benefit if you plan to sell your house in the near future or simply moving to a new place.
Like any other fire feature, ethanol fireplaces should never be employed in homes with tight seals or small indoor spaces, and should be located close to a carbon monoxide detector. They should also only be used with ethanol fuel that is designed for this fireplace. The use of a different fuel could cause fires and explosions.
3. Easy to maintain
Ethanol fireplaces are far more easy to maintain than traditional fireplaces. They don't create soot or ash, and they can be used indoors or out. They don't need a chimney, so they're an excellent choice for apartments. Installation is usually simple and straightforward, and anyone who can utilize a drill is able to complete it.
It is important to keep your ethanol fireplace filled up with fuel and clean the fire occasionally. Keep all flammable substances away from the Fireplace stove (yxzbookmarks.com). Only use the amount of fuel that the manufacturer suggests. Insufficient fuel could cause the flame to become too large and potentially cause combustible items to catch fire. It's also important to place the fireplace where it isn't able to be hit or damaged by objects that are moved around it while it's on.
Most ethanol fireplaces do not produce lots of heat, and therefore should not be used as a primary source of heat. The exception to this is some models that can be adjusted to a temperature setting. The higher the setting, the more heat it generates.
When selecting an ethanol fire, it's important to look for one that is certified by a credible organization. This can be an indication that the manufacturer is committed to safety. Also, look for features that will help you keep your fireplace safe, like an enclosure that regulates the size of the flame and an empty tray.
There are many styles and sizes of Ethanol fireplaces. They can be mounted like a flat-screen TV or they can be recessed into the wall. The majority of ethanol fireplaces have mounting hardware, so you can simply screw it into the wall and plug it into. If you want to recess the bio fire into your wall, you'll require the help of an expert to do it. You can purchase prefabricated wall-mounted ethanol fireplaces between $300 and $5,600. Or you can employ a professional to complete the work for you. Installing a wall-mounted Bio fire should take around an hour.
4. Improves the Value of Your Home
Ethanol fireplaces can add a touch of class to any house. They are very modern and elegant, and do not require chimneys like traditional fireplaces do. The greatest benefit is that they can be set up in any room of the home and are simple to maintain. The only thing you need to remember is to take basic safety precautions and follow the instructions given by the manufacturer. In this way, you will be able to enjoy your ethanol fireplace for many years to be.
There are a variety of ethanol fire places that you can choose from. It is important to select one that fits your style and requirements. You can get a freestanding fireplace that is able to be moved around to where you'd like or opt for one that is wall-mounted and integrated into the walls of your home. Both options are great for adding a touch of luxury to your home, and can increase the value of your home too.
If you are in search of an ethanol fireplace that you can purchase make sure you choose one that has been tested. This means that it has been certified by UL to comply with certain standards. It is crucial to follow the instructions and keep it away from flammable objects and curtains. Keep a carbon monoxide alarm near the ethanol fire source and ensure that the room is well-ventilated.
You should also remember that ethanol fireplaces don't burn for very long, so you must ensure that you have a sufficient supply of fuel to make use of it. It is recommended to keep your fireplace clean to prevent the accumulation of dirt or other debris.
Ethanol Fireplaces are an excellent choice for anyone looking to add a touch of luxury their home, without spending much. They are also easy to use and don't create a lot of smoke or ash. They are also an excellent source of heat that can be used in almost every room in the house.
